Moderate Flood Warning For The Herbert River
Issued at 12:14 PM AEST on Monday 05 January 2026
Flood Warning Number: 11
MODERATE FLOODING LIKELY AT HALIFAX LATE MONDAY EVENING
MINOR FLOODING OCCURRING AT GLENEAGLE AND ABERGOWRIE BRIDGE
Recent moderate to heavy rainfall has resulted in river level rises across the Herbert River catchment. Minor flooding is occurring at Gleneagle and Abergowrie Bridge. Moderate flooding is likely from late Monday evening at Halifax. At this stage, flooding is not expected at Ingham Pump Station and Gairloch.
Further rainfall is forecast over the coming days. This situation is being closely monitored, and this warning will be updated as required.
A Flood Watch is current for adjoining catchments.
Herbert River to Nash's Crossing:
Minor flooding is occurring along the Herbert River at Gleneagle.
No observations are currently available for the Herbert River at Gleneagle Homestead. Based on the nearby automatic gauge, river levels are expected to be above the minor flood level.
The Herbert River at Gleneagle Homestead is likely to remain above the minor flood level (4.50 m) over the next few days. Further rises are possible with forecast rainfall.
Herbert River downstream of Nash's Crossing:
Moderate flooding is likely along the Herbert River at Halifax, with minor flooding occurring at Abergowrie Bridge.
The Herbert River at Abergowrie Bridge is currently at 7.27 m and steady, with minor flooding.
The Herbert River at Abergowrie Bridge is likely to remain above the minor flood level (6.00 m) for the next few days. Further rises are possible with forecast rainfall.
The Herbert River at Halifax is currently at 4.01 m and rising, with minor flooding.
The Herbert River at Halifax is likely to reach around the moderate flood level (4.50 m) Monday evening. Further rises are possible with forecast rain.
